在Node-RED上,当我们按Ctrl+f
键并键入一个单词时,我们可以看到包含该特定单词的所有节点。当我有不同的节点同时在函数节点和模板节点上承载代码时,有时在外部编辑器上打开所有选定的节点或过滤的节点会很有用。这样我就可以在我的节点上进行一些批量编辑(尽管Node-RED组织了代码的主要思想,但我错过了一次在多个节点上编辑代码的可能性)。在我的特定情况下,我知道如何使用Vim,以及如何使用它一次编辑多个文件。那么,在Node-RED上可以做到吗?我可以将Node-RED配置为在已安装在系统上的外部编辑器上打开模板和功能节点的内容吗?
我知道这个功能意味着编辑器将在浏览器之外打开,并且它只能在我安装了Node-RED的计算机上工作。这就是我有时需要的那种功能,用来批量重命名一些变量,并在不同的文件中编辑类似的代码块。
发布于 2021-04-28 15:18:24
不不可能。
最接近的是contrib节点,它支持将功能节点中的代码存储在单独的文件中。我知道它是构建的,但我在https://flows.nodered.org上找不到它,而且我认为它没有随着核心功能节点的更改/更新而保持最新。它也不提供启动编辑器来编辑这些文件的方法,也不提供在文件发生更改时触发部署的方法。
https://stackoverflow.com/questions/67291309
复制相似问题